Output 51a1d3293d77ee21f48dbfe88586c814c7fb90c19cd9afc8882fb45cab89c27e:1

value
7105126
script pubkey
OP_0 OP_PUSHBYTES_20 63970ae652b66a82a82fdaa6bb9a8c4c57a2e52b
address
bc1qvwts4ejjke4g92p0m2nthx5vf3t69eftx9yuda
transaction
51a1d3293d77ee21f48dbfe88586c814c7fb90c19cd9afc8882fb45cab89c27e
confirmations
149501
spent
true